Synopsis "History of the Development of the Doctrine of the Person of Christ; Volume 2"

First published in 1861, this classic work of theology explores the history of the Christian doctrine of the person of Christ. Drawing on a wide range of sources, Dorner traces the evolution of this important doctrine from the early church to the present day. With its detailed analysis and careful scholarship, this book remains a valuable resource for scholars of theology and Christian history.This work has been selected by scholars as being culturally important, and is part of the knowledge base of civilization as we know it.This work is in the "public domain in the United States of America, and possibly other nations.
